• National Professional Qualifications (NPQs) are a national suite of qualifications designed to support the professional development of teachers and leaders.

• We’re committed to ensuring that NPQs continue to offer the best possible support to teachers and leaders wanting to expand their knowledge and skills. That’s why have introduced a reformed suite of National Professional Qualifications (NPQs) from September 2021.

• The frameworks continue the robust method of design and development, building on the evidence base and expert guidance already established in the ECF and the ITT Core Content Framework

Duration and Learning Hours

12

Qualification Type  Taught Course Duration*  Summative Assessment Period*

Total Duration to award of final mark

Specialist NPQs  12 months  3 months  15 months NPQSL  18 months  3 months  21 months NPQH  18 months 

With flexibility to extend by up to 6 months for Teachers new to the role of headship 

3 months  21 months Up to 27 months for Teachers new to the role of headship 

NPQEL  18 months  3 months  21 months NPQH Additional Support Offer

Minimum 12 months (covering first year in role)

N/A Minimum 12 months

NPQ Minimum Hours CriteriaQualification Type  Minimum Overall Hours  Minimum Synchronous Delivery  Minimum In Person Delivery 

Specialist NPQs  50 hours  20 hours  8 hours Leadership NPQs  75 hours  30 hours  12 hours NPQH Additional Support Offer for New head Teachers

>8 day window>Based on a case study which is different for each assessment window

>1500 words>There are two assessment windows per NPQ per year>Participants can sit the assessment twice
